How to transfer the same SOA Archive from development to production environment without re-compiling ?
Use configuration plan file along with SOA Achieve.
The instance of the composite applications gets created when some one invoke the composite application using the url.
What happens when WLS comes up with SOA Infra application ?
1. Read SOA Infra configuration from MDS
2. Start the basic services and wait for the requests.
3. Route request to service engines and binding components
4. Manage life cycle.
SOA Infra application will get connected to database using default connections pools. The composite application can connect to seperate application databases.
1. SOA Infra database connections to MDS
2. The composite application could connect to application database using separate connection pools at run time.

BPEL:
For BPEL every thing outside is WSDL. Eg. File adatpor is a WSDL, invoking an EJB is WSDL. JDeveloper creates WSDL for every interaction outside BPEL. Each WSDL is a web service.
BPEL is basically orchestrating the web services. Internally BPEL has global variable and local variable. The local variables limited to scope. During monitoring each variable value can been seen. BEPL can have multiple activities and conditional logics. BPEL process never ends untill it is over evan if the server crashes.
The state of BPEL process is stored in SOA INFRA table. Each variables value is stored in SOA Infra table. So when the server crashes it will start when the server comes back.
Concurrently we can only run run the composite application instances, each run run instances will take one thread. However if the instances running does not mean that it is consuming a thread. This is applicable only for As synchronous. For Synchronous, we may have a Thread issue if the concurrent users exceeds the available threads.
BPEL Process can have transaction. Define dehydration point so that the transaction ends and data commits.

Dehydration points:
Storing the current status of the BPEL process into the Database is known as dehydration. The Dehydration Store database is used to store BPEL process status data, especially for asynchronous BPEL processes. Also, all successfully executed BPEL process instances are stored in the dehydration store. The database schema is created for this as a part of SOA Suite installation is ORABPEL schema. Security - External LDAP for WebLogic
Go to security realm and providers, then create a new authentication provider, Select type as Active Directory. Control flag specify if the authentication provide is only one or one of many. If many, then use "optional" from the drop down box under common.
We can have multiple ldap system added to weblogic admin. The control flag determines which one will get precedents. Ideally we can have one external LDAP and one internal LDAP and have one admin id on each.

Difference between SOA Suite (Mediator) and OSB (Oracle Service bus)
Mediator:
- Tiny, Light weight Service Bus
- Used for VETRO Pattern (Validate, Enrich, Transform, Routing, Operate)
- Value mapping and cross reference for supporting Canonical Data Model
- Message Transformation with XSLT
- Part of SCA.(Service Component Architecture)
- Large powerful service bus.
- Great for Enterprise wide integration
- Message Transformation with XSLT and XQUERY
- Not Integrated with SCA
